Concordia Edges SU with Final Push

Concordia used a late 11-5 run in the final 2-1/2 minutes of regulation to break the game's 10th tie and give Schreiner another tough loss, 73-67.  Schreiner had just taken its last lead of the night, 62-60 on a jumper by sophomore Courtney Davis, but CTX (9-5 in ASC) scored the next 8 points and held the edge in the final minute of action.

Schreiner started slowly, caught back up and then watched the Tornadoes take an 11 point lead midway through the opening half.  The Mountaineers (4-11 in ASC) used a 9-4 run to get back within five but CTX carried an eight point lead into the locker room, 33-25.

In the second half, SU again started slowly and fell behind by 13, 47-34, before mounting their charge.  SU outscored Concordia, 14-1, over the next seven minutes and then the two teams traded baskets and the lead.  There would be four lead changes and six ties over the next seven minutes but it was Concordia's final push that decided the outcome.

Schreiner used only seven players - and three starters (junior Monica Enriquez, senior Lynn Stow and freshman Anna Fareed) played all 40 minutes of action.  SU was again controlled on the offensive glass, being out-rebounded 19-11, but shot a sizzling 60% in the second half.  27 turnovers hurt their chances of success.  Enriquez had another strong night, scoring 20 points and adding seven rebounds, seven assists and five steals.  Davis rebounded from a recent scoring and shooting slump with 17 points on 8-for-13 shooting.  Fareed contributed 14 points and 7 rebounds.

CTX was led by Jennifer Herman with a game-high 26 points and Laneen Harris' 20 rebounds.
